Cab enclosures designed for John Deere equipment offer protection from the elements, enhancing operator comfort and productivity regardless of weather conditions. These enclosures typically consist of durable materials like polycarbonate or glass, providing shelter from rain, snow, wind, and excessive sun exposure. A climate-controlled cab, for instance, might include features such as heating, air conditioning, and ventilation.
Operator well-being and efficient work output are significantly improved through the use of such protective measures. By shielding operators from harsh weather, these enclosures contribute to increased focus and reduced fatigue, resulting in improved safety and productivity. Historically, agricultural and construction equipment operators faced considerable exposure to the elements. The evolution of enclosed cabs represents a significant advancement in operator safety and comfort, directly impacting overall work quality and efficiency.
